Email Killer, Slack Launches Us$80 Million Fund For Developers


Slack, a team communication app and the killer of email has announced the launch of a US$80 million fund to support developers building apps that interact with Slack.
The Slack Fund focuses primarily on “Slack-first” apps but developers building B2B and enterprise tools that make Slack integrations a core part of their offering will also be able to access the fund.


The fund is open to developers working in every industry from anywhere in the world.
“We’ll measure the success of the Slack Fund in the quality and adoption of the apps built by Slack Fund companies and by the overall investment we see in the Slack ecosystem,”Slack stated on its blog.
Interested developers or small company in Africa can access The Slack Fund by sending an email to slackfund@slack.com
As a way of showing commitment to The Slack Fund, Slack has already invested in three companies – small wins; awesome.ai and Howdy.
The fund is backed by investors such as Accel, Andressen Horowitz, Index Ventures, KPCB, Social Capital and Spark Capital.
Also, Slack announced the launch of a brand new Slack App Directory, which houses over 160 apps that can extend the capabilities of Slack teams, sorted into curated lists by category, popularity and staff favorites.
Simply put, the Slack App Directory will enable teams to find apps that would make them work smarter and faster.
Since launch in 2013, Slack has gradually become the darling app for workplace collaboration. This year, more than one million people have used Slack actively on a daily basis.
